The Evolving Cannabis Supply Chain
The cannabis industry is in a constant state of flux, and its supply chain is no exception. Historically, the process operated from cultivation to dispensary shelves with limited intermediaries. Today, however, the landscape is becoming increasingly complex. As demand escalates, new stakeholders are emerging in the supply chain, creating a more integrated network.
This shift is driven by several factors, including expanding consumer demand, reform efforts in various regions, and technological advancements that are enhancing operations. Including centralized warehousing to innovative tracking systems, the cannabis supply chain is becoming more effective than ever before.
- A key example of this evolution is the rise of third-party logistics providers who specialize in transporting cannabis products.
- Moreover, the use of blockchain technology is growing traction as a way to improve transparency and traceability throughout the supply chain.
As the cannabis industry continues to mature, we can expect to see even more advancements in the supply chain, consequently benefiting both businesses and consumers alike.
